In today’s fast-paced digital world, mobile apps have become crucial for businesses aiming to thrive and stand out in the competitive market. With the increasing reliance on smartphones for everyday activities, companies, especially startups, small businesses, and entrepreneurs, recognize the importance of a dedicated mobile app to enhance operational efficiency, customer engagement, and overall growth.

Importance of Mobile App Development for Businesses

The digital age has ushered in a new era where consumer preferences and behaviors constantly evolve, necessitating businesses to adopt agile and innovative strategies. A well-designed mobile app is a direct channel for businesses to offer services, engage with customers, and reinforce their brand. This vital tool improves customer satisfaction and significantly contributes to business growth.

Top Benefits of Hiring a Professional Mobile App Development Company

Hiring a professional mobile app development company brings many advantages that can catapult a business to the forefront of its industry. From leveraging expert knowledge and advanced technologies to ensuring a seamless, user-friendly experience, these companies specialize in creating apps that resonate with your target audience. Here are the top benefits of partnering with experts in mobile app development:

Expertise and Experience

  • Access to skilled professionals who stay updated with the latest trends and technologies.
  • Benefit from their vast experience developing apps across different platforms, ensuring your app is tailored to meet your business needs and customer expectations.

Quality and Reliability

  • Assurance of a high-quality app that undergoes rigorous testing for a seamless user experience.
  • Dependability on the company to deliver your project within the stipulated timelines and budget.


  • Hiring a company can often be more cost-effective than setting up an in-house team, especially for one-off projects or startups.
  • Avoid the costs associated with training, salaries, and benefits for a developer team.

Focus on Core Business Operations

  • It lets you concentrate on other crucial aspects of your business while the development team handles the technical work.
  • Saves time and resources, enabling quicker turnaround times for market entry.

Ongoing Support and Maintenance

  • Provides continuous support and maintenance post-launch to address any issues or updates.
  • Ensures your app remains compatible with new operating systems and devices.

Factors to Consider When Choosing a Mobile App Development CompanyPortfolio and Experience

  • Review their past projects and client testimonials to gauge their expertise and success in delivering quality apps.
  • Consider their experience in developing apps similar to your concept and target audience.

Technical Skills and Expertise

  • Ensure the company has experience and knowledge in the specific platforms and technologies required for your app.
  • Look into their team’s technical skills, certifications, and ongoing training to stay updated with the latest developments.

Communication and Collaboration

  • Look for a company that values clear communication and collaboration throughout development.
  • Regular updates and effective communication ensure your vision is accurately translated into the final product.

Cost and Budget

  • Consider the upfront cost and any additional fees for ongoing support and maintenance.
  • Compare quotes from different companies to find a balance between quality and affordability.

Timeframe and Project Management

  • Clarify the expected timeline for project completion, including milestones and delivery dates.
  • Understand their project management process to ensure efficient and timely delivery of your app.

A Step-by-Step Guide to the Mobile App Development Process

  1. Conceptualization: Define your app’s goals, target audience, and functionalities.
  2. Planning: Outline the app’s structure, features, and design elements.
  3. Design and User Experience: Focus on creating an intuitive design and seamless user experience.
  4. Development: The coding phase where developers build the app’s functionality.
  5. Testing: Rigorously test the app for bugs, usability, and compatibility.
  6. Launch: Deploy the app on respective platforms (iOS, Android).
  7. Maintenance and Updates: Continuous support to fix bugs and update the app as needed.

The Future of Mobile Apps and Staying Ahead

The future of mobile apps is geared towards integrating advanced technologies like AI, IoT, and AR/VR, offering personalized and immersive user experiences. Businesses that leverage these technologies and continuously update their apps based on user feedback and market trends will stay ahead in the competitive landscape. Partnering with a mobile app development company with the expertise and resources to incorporate these emerging technologies into your app is crucial. Regularly analyzing your app’s performance and making necessary updates will keep it relevant and engaging for users. Continuous innovation is key to staying ahead in the ever-evolving world of mobile apps.


Investing in a mobile app development company can bring unparalleled benefits to your business, from tapping into their expertise and experience to saving time and costs. It’s a strategic move that can significantly enhance customer engagement, operational efficiency, and business growth. By choosing the right partner and staying informed about the latest mobile app development trends, businesses can remain competitive and continue to thrive in the digital age.

